Trix Rosen’s Illuminations at Art House Gallery

April 9, 2019 by trixrosen

You are Cordially Invited to View

A retrospective exhibition which traces a half-century of groundbreaking photographs from Trix Rosen


julie with studded collar trix rosen boudoir photography

RosenCard back card info

Opening Reception Date

Sunday, May 5th, 2019 3-6 pm

Presenting portraits celebrating gender-fluidity, photographs of endangered architecture, laser-light drawings and the Maîtresse slideshow, last seen at MoMA (2017-2018) in the CLUB 57: Film, Performance and Art in the East Village 1978-1983 Exhibition.

Art House Gallery

262 17th Street, Jersey City NJ 07310
Curated by Andrea McKenna

Illuminations runs until June 2, 2019

About Trix Rosen

Trix Rosen was a visionary photographer known for capturing powerful narratives transcending the ordinary. Her work explored themes of gender identity, social justice, and architectural heritage. Notable projects such as “HE-SHE,” “CHILDHOOD MEMORIES,” and “URBAN ARCHEOLOGY & MODERN RUINS” celebrated the unseen and overlooked aspects of life.
